Wanted players throughts on whether the Top 20 provisioner system should be changed from a list of the top 20 players to a list of top 20 linkshells instead?

Arguments for:

1. In most LS's players funnel items into one player anyway so why not avoid this nuisance by letting all players hand in and contribute to the linkshell's rating instead? The whole funnelling system seems a bit archaic similar to how the market wards was a step backwards from an auction house if you understand my thinking.

2. If you funnel items into one player, and then that player cannot commit to runs for real life reasons (unexpected work or family issue, power outage, etc) then that would be a waste of time and a frustation to the remaining members. It also puts undue pressure on the nominated player who may force to sacrifrice real life issues.

3. It would actually encourage LSs to become more cohesive as there would be an LS reputation/image to contribute towards. At the moment in FF14 LS's have no reputation or honour, whereas in 11 certain LS's built up reputations in various ways among the playerbase.

4. The Top 3 positions should then be altered to a system whereby any LS can get that extra benefit (a guaranted seal) if their supply rating is over 1 million points, 2mil, 3mil etc. You could then have multiple slots in the top 20 having that benefit if the work hard enough. That would encourage players to participate more I should imagine as relic seals can be less elusive in the long term.

5. At the moment it is top 20 players competing against the server, but what if subscription numbers inflated after version2, that would be a lot of competition so it makes sense to narrow it down to linkshells to be a more realistic competition

I'm sure some players will say if you go midweek there is less points usually required for top 20, but that doesnt really address the above points or whole administration problems the current system has i believe.
